A new biography revealing the personal story of the powerful, doomed minister to Henry VIII.
Thomas Cromwell was King Henry VIII's most faithful servant, the only man the king ever openly regretted executing. But Cromwell came to royal prominence late in life, and had forty-five years of family, friends, and experiences behind him before catching Henry's eye.
